What Are CBSE Class 10 Competency-Based Questions?

There is a simple explanation: a normal question in NCERT asks you what you know! Competency based questions: asks you what you can do with what you know.

Take Maths. The basic question could be: What are the solutions of the quadratic equation x² – 5x + 6 = 0? However, a competency-based version of the same idea would call for a farmer to partition a rectangular field into two equal parts, provide the total area, and then ask you to determine the dimensions of the field by solving quadratic equations. You are making the same calculation. The context is just (just in case definition) real and unfamiliar, so you’re forced to think.

This is because of the shift in the National Education policy 2020 (NEP 2020) that advocated for a move away from rote learning to application-based assessment by CBSE. According to CBSE’s official circular (Acad-15/2024), it aims to create ‘an educational ecosystem based on critical thinking and real-life applications.’ The CBSE Class 10 competency-based questions are directly aligned with this framework as released in the CFPQ and CACBTI.

Quick insight: Competency based questions are not harder, they are different. After gaining the understanding that the answer will always be based on an NCERT concept in a new scenario, the format becomes very manageable after practicing it.

CBSE Class 10 Competency-Based Question Paper Pattern 2026-27

CBSE has split the Class 10 paper into two equal halves. One-half tests what you know. The other half of the competency-based questions tests what you can do with what you know:

Competency-Based Questions – 50% of the Paper

These show up in four formats:

  • Application-Based MCQs (where the wrong options are designed around common mistakes)
  • Case-based questions (a short scenario followed by 3-4 sub-questions),
  • Source-based questions (a document, map, or cartoon you have to analyse)
  • Application-based Questions – like infographics in English or experiment-based deductions in Science.

Other Question Types (50%)

The other half consists of direct multiple-choice questions with fixed answer choices, in addition to short and long answer questions in which step-wise marking is applied, so that a correct method with a wrong final answer still receives some of the marks.

One thing worth knowing: CBSE releases the Competency Focused Practice Questions chapter-wise, not section-wise. So there is a dedicated set for Real Numbers, a separate set for Life Processes, and so on, making it easy to practise alongside your chapter revision.

Pro tip: Start with chapters that have the highest weightage in the board paper, Quadratic Equations and Coordinate Geometry in Maths, Electricity and Chemical Reactions in Science. These chapters appear most frequently in case-based question sets.

CFPQ vs CACBTI – What Is the Difference and Which Should You Use First?

A lot of students download both and are not sure where to start. Here is a clean comparison:

CFPQ (with Solutions) CACBTI (Test Only)
Has answer key? Yes, detailed, step-wise solutions No for self-testing
Best used for Learning and understanding the format Simulating exam conditions
When to use Early in your preparation After finishing the CFPQ practice
Released by CBSE + Educational Initiatives (Ei) CBSE

Always start with CFPQ. Understand the format, check your solutions, and read the marking scheme to see what examiners reward. Then shift to CACBTI when you want to test yourself under timed conditions.

Subject-Wise Overview: What Do These PDFs Actually Contain?

Science

The CBSE Class 10 Science competency-based questions PDF is chapter-wise and covers all three sections – Physics, Chemistry, and Biology. Questions are mostly scenario or experiment-based. Always draw diagrams; they carry separate marks even when the written answer is incomplete.

Mathematics

The CBSE Class 10 Maths competency-based questions with solutions in the CFPQ cover all 14 chapters, with Quadratic Equations, Arithmetic Progressions, and Statistics appearing most in case-study format. The maths is NCERT-level only; the real-life framing is new.

English

The CBSE Class 10 English competency-based questions witness a definite change in the structure of unseen passages that become infographic in nature (tables, flowcharts, graphs) instead of paragraphs. Writing activities, such as letters and notices, are based on authentic contexts.

Social Science

The CBSE Class 10 Social Science competency-based questions are mostly source-based: historical excerpts, political cartoons, maps, or data tables, followed by analysis questions. The skill being tested is interpretation, not memorisation.

How to Actually Use These Practice Questions Without Wasting Time

The majority of students download and read these PDFs passively, or try to do them without a plan. Here are some things that really help:

  • Revise the NCERT chapter first. Competency-based questions test the application of chapter concepts. If the concept itself is not clear, the application will not be either. Always read the chapter before attempting the CFPQ for that topic.
  • When using case-study sets: Read through the text once. Use underlining to highlight numbers, units and key terms. Recognize the NCERT chapter to which the scenario belongs and then solve each sub-question according to that chapter method.
  • Always write your work: Even in Science and Maths case-based questions and step wise grading of marks is given. Partial credit is given if a student gives the wrong answer, but the procedure is correct.
  • Check the CBSE Marking Scheme, not just the answer. The Marking Scheme PDF (also on cbseacademic.nic.in) has a ‘Commonly Made Errors’ section for each question, which tells you exactly what examiners penalise.
  • Switch to CACBTI after finishing CFPQ. Attempt CACBTI papers under timed, exam-like conditions, no notes, strict time. Then verify your answers against your NCERT knowledge and CFPQ solutions.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q. What are competency-based questions in Class 10?

In competency-based questions you are expected to demonstrate your understanding of the material, rather than to know the facts. Rather than ‘Define photosynthesis,’ a CBQ could describe an experiment with a plant, asking you to predict what would happen and explain why.

Q. How much weightage do competency-based questions carry in the 2027 boards?

Exactly 50% of the total theory marks, so in an 80-mark paper like Science or Maths, 40 marks will come from competency-based items. This is confirmed under the NEP 2020-aligned assessment framework and applies to the CBSE Class 10 board exam 2027.

Q. Are the CBSE Class 10 Competency-Based Practice Questions PDFs free?

Yes, completely. These resources are published by CBSE in collaboration with Educational Initiatives (Ei) and are available for free on cbseacademic.nic.in. No login, registration, or payment is required.

Q. How do I solve competency-based questions in Class 10 Maths?

Start by identifying which chapter the scenario maps to. If the question describes a savings plan with increasing monthly deposits, that is an arithmetic progression. If it talks about the shadow of a tower, that is Trigonometry. Once you identify the chapter, solve using the relevant formula or method and write every step, because step-wise marks apply even when the final answer is wrong.

Q. Does the CBSE Class 10 competency-based question pattern change every year?

The pattern 50% competency-based, 50% traditional is fixed under CBSE’s NEP 2020 framework and is not changing for the 2026-27 session. However, the specific scenarios and passages in the actual exam will always be new. That is why practising with CBSE Class 10 competency-based questions matters.
